[0024] A method for preparing chewable grains, fruits and vegetables for clearing away heat and dampness, is characterized in that it comprises the following steps:

[0025] (1) Dry and grind the equal mass of Smilax glabra and Pueraria lobata root into powder and put them into the extraction pot, add 5 times the amount of 70% ethanol, shake and extract 3 times in ultrasonic at 75°C to obtain the extract;

[0026] (2) The above-mentioned filtrate is pumped into a vacuum concentration pot and concentrated into a thick extract, which is centrifuged and spray-dried to obtain the mixed powder of Pueraria lobata root;

[0027] (3) Clean and drain the wheat germ, brown rice, corn and red beans, bake at 50°C until the moisture content is 4-6%, smash through an 80-100 mesh sieve to obtain whole grain flour;

The invention discloses a preparation method of cereal, fruit and vegetable chewable tablets capable of clearing heat and eliminating dampness. Compound fruit and vegetable powder prepared from sweetpotatoes, carrots and pumpkins, glabrous greenbrier rhizome and radix puerariae mixed powder and the like are added to cereal powder prepared from raw materials of wheat germs, brown rice, corn and red beans for blending, so that the cereal, fruit and vegetable chewable tablets comprehensive in nutrients are obtained. Compared with an extrusion puffing and cooking technology, a baking and frying technology adopted by the preparation method disclosed by the invention has the characteristics of being low in equipment investment and large in processing quantity, the prepared cereal powder has rich scorch aroma, and is low in water absorption rate, low in viscosity and easy to disperse in water, water molecules are in sufficient contact with other materials, and agglomerating is not liable togenerate; a radio frequency sterilizing technique is utilized, so that the problem of microbial contamination of low-water-activity foods is solved; the cereal, fruit and vegetable chewable tablets prepared by the technology disclosed by the invention have the advantages of being convenient to carry, good in mouth feel, stable in quality, long in product shelf life and the like, nutrient components are easy to absorb, and after being eaten for a long term, the cereal, fruit and vegetable chewable tablets also have the advantages of clearing heat, eliminating dampness and reliving constipation.

Technical field [0001] The invention relates to the technical field of health food processing, in particular to a method for preparing a chewable tablet for clearing heat and removing dampness from cereals, fruits and vegetables. Background technique [0002] Cereals, fruits and vegetables are rich in nutrients and contain a lot of dietary fiber, vitamins, and minerals. They are indispensable nutritional supplements for people. However, there are many kinds of cereals, fruits and vegetables, and they are rich in nutrients. Consumers cook and process them by themselves, which is time-consuming and laborious, and it is difficult to ensure the quality of eating. Therefore, the development of convenient, delicious, chewable tablets rich in a variety of cereals and fruits and vegetables has become a research hotspot for food processing companies and developers.
